2026 FIFA World Cup Host Cities Overview

The 2026 FIFA World Cup will be jointly hosted by the United States, Canada, and Mexico, marking the first time three nations will stage the tournament together. New York City, specifically the renovated MetLife Stadium in East Rutherford, New Jersey, is designated as one of the sixteen venues selected to host the 80 matches. This choice underscores the region’s capability to organize large-scale, high-profile events on a global stage.
